Effect of pericapsular nerve group block with different concentrations and volumes of Ropivacaine on functional recovery in total hip arthroplasty

Experts aimed to conduct a prospective randomized trial to test whether reducing the volume or concentration of Ropivacaine was better for less motor block after PENG block. Findings showed that a higher incidence of motor blockade was observed when 20 mL of 0.5% Ropivacaine was administered, which was mainly caused by excessive volume. Therefore, we recommend performing PENG block with 10 mL 0.5% Ropivacaine.
